The Persian Wars

Lecture no. 13 from the course: Ancient Greek Civilization

Loading the player...

Taught by Professor Jeremy McInerney | 31 min | Categories: History

The Persian Wars, 490-479 B.C.E, were probably of more consequence to the Greeks than to the Persians. From these confrontations the Greeks articulated their idea of eleutheria (freedom), which is still embedded in Western culture. What was freedom as the Greeks conceived it?...
